Lets compare vitamin content per 100 grams of Sunflower Seeds vs Leavening agents, cream of tartar:
Dried Sunflower Seed Kernels have more Vitamin B1, more Vitamin B2, more Vitamin B3, more Vitamin B5, more Vitamin B6, more Vitamin B9, more Vitamin C and more Vitamin E than Leavening agents, cream of tartar.
Both Dried Sunflower Seed Kernels as well as Leavening agents, cream of tartar have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12, Vitamin D and Vitamin K in 100 g.
Comparing minerals per 100 grams for Sunflower Seeds vs Leavening agents, cream of tartar:
Dried Sunflower Seed Kernels have 9.8 times more Calcium, 9.2 times more Copper, 1.4 times more Iron, 162.5 times more Magnesium, 9.5 times more Manganese, 132 times more Phosphorus, 265 times more Selenium and 11.9 times more Zinc than Leavening agents, cream of tartar.
While Leavening agents, cream of tartar contain 25.6 times more Potassium and 5.8 times more Sodium than Dried Sunflower Seed Kernels.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 grams:
Dried Sunflower Seed Kernels have 2.3 times more Energy, more Fat, more Saturated Fat, more Omega 3, more Omega 6, more Sugars, 43 times more Fiber and more Protein than Leavening agents, cream of tartar.
While Leavening agents, cream of tartar contain 3.1 times more Carbohydrate than Dried Sunflower Seed Kernels.
Both Dried Sunflower Seed Kernels as well as Leavening agents, cream of tartar have insufficient amounts of Cholesterol, Glucose and Sucrose in 100 g.
